    Independent films‚ more commonly known as indie films‚ are films not made by mainstream production houses or movie studios. They are independent of the influences‚ authority‚ and control of the mainstream industry (Makuha‚ 2010). The emergence of new and highly-advanced cameras in the market and the advancement of technology have spawned the growth of indie films.
